Update: Drowning Of Boonton Mom, 11-Year-Old Son Ruled Accidental The deaths of a 35-year-old Morris County mom and her 11-year-old son have been ruled accidental, authorities said Tuesday. The bodies of Warda Syed and Uzair Ahmed were recovered from the Upper Pond section of Grace Lord Park in Boonton on Feb. 23. Police were called to the scene for reports of an unattended 6-year-old -- later identified as Syed’s child, who was unharmed, authorities said previously. Witness: Man Who Plunged To Death At Paterson's Great Falls Slipped On Rocks A man who plunged to his death from atop the Great Falls in Paterson on Thursday apparently slipped and fell, a witness told police. Firefighters recovered the body of the victim who was believed to be 40 to 50 years old, after the witness said he saw him “climbing the rocks, falling forward and then falling backward,” a responder at the scene told Daily Voice. The victim had no pulse when he was pulled from the water onto land after falling around 4 p.m.  Rescuers conducted CPR in an attempt to revive him to no avail. North Bergen Woman Found Dead At Jersey Shore: Report A woman from Hudson County was found dead on a beach in Highlands Sunday morning, News 4 New York reported.  Melissa Fries, 37, was reported missing Saturday night after going swimming with friends.  State Police, Highland police, the U.S. Coast Guard and other agencies joined in a water search for the woman, who was reported missing around 11:15 p.m.  An investigation into the precise cause of death was pending an autopsy, but it appears to be accidental, authorities also said.
